St. Mark Orthodox Christian Church
Named after the Apostle and Evangelist St. Mark, our church is a small community of Orthodox Christians with various national and cultural backgrounds.
Many of us were born and raised in different countries: the United States, Greece, Russian, Serbia, Ukraine, Belarus, Romania, Germany, Finland, Poland, and many others.
We may have different traditions to follow in our everyday life, but we all have one thing in common - the same belief, the same Christian ideals, the strong desire to grow spiritually, the interest and respect to many different cultures and traditions.
Our church serves people from as far North as St. Petersburg, including Sun City, Parish, Bradenton, Parrish, and as far South as Sarasota, Venice (Florida) since 1979.
